Describe anything about the history of the quilt that wasn't already recorded in a previous field:

This friendship signature quilt is machine pieced of solid, checked, geometric, and dotted fabric in blue and white, with blue and white sashing and borders. There are names embroidered in red in the blocks. HowAcquired: Donated to the Rocky Mountain Quilt Museum by Marion Roth of Arvada, CO. Ownership/History: Made as a going-away gift for Sarah Frame Portis (Mrs. David), of Lake George, CO, when she moved to Jefferson, Park County, CO, to live with her son Eli Portis. It is unclear who made the blocks, as many of them include husband and wife signatures. LocMade: ///CO//USA
